关于开展“2016年全国职业院校技能大赛” Web view2018年全国职业院校技能大赛. 赛项申报书. 赛项名称:移动互联网应用软件开发. 赛项类别:常规赛项

Embed Size (px)

Citation preview

2016

2018

/

2017822

2018

610212

610205

++

UIMVPUIMaterialDesignHandler//MPAndroidChart API

GB8566-88

92018 201830

UIAndroid3~5

IT

1.

2.1

3.

1

2

ITIT2025

20172018

5AndroidAndroidJavaHTML5HTML5Java Web60

2018 201830

2018SDK

MVPUIMaterialDesignHandler//MPAndroidChart API

1.5%

2.10%

3

3.79%

App8

4.6%

4

The mobile Internet application software development competition, which applies the real cases in intelligent transportation enterprises, tests the contestants coding ability, document writing ability, comprehensive analysis ability, technical architecture design ability, creative innovation ability, and big data analysis ability in real projects through the four testing forms of "system documentation", "program troubleshooting", "functional coding" and "creative design". The testing technical points include MVP design patterns, UI design standards MaterialDesign, four components, resource using, Handler / multithreading / timers, network request framework, data wrapping and parsing, multimedia, gesture recognition, dependency injection, event delivery, memory leak management, data storage, business logic, data mining and open source chart library MPAndroidChart API and so on.

The contents and scores of the competition are as follows.

1. System documentation (5%)

The system documentation module mainly tests the system design capability of the contestants. The complete system requirement specification and the functional modules list, which need systematic and detailed design, will be provided to the contestants by the competition committee during the competition. The contestants complete the outline of modules in the list, and detailed functions design, then output the design document according to the requirements of provided modules.

2. Program troubleshooting (10%)

The program troubleshooting mainly tests the code reading ability and defect modification ability of contestants. A certain part of intelligent project code and three defect reports will be provided to the contestants by the competition committee during the competition. The contestants locate the code position that the defaults are in, and modify the code to realize the correct functions according to the defects described in the defect reports.

3. Function coding (79%)

The function coding module mainly tests the code writing ability of contestants. The complete system requirement specification and relevant App framework code will be provided to the contestants by the competition committee during the competition. The contestants complete the coding of eight function modules or methods referring the provided documents according to the test requirements.

4. Creative design (6%)

The creative design module mainly tests the creative design ability of contestants. A "creative" entrance will be provided in uncertain interface to the contestants by the competition committee during the competition. The contestants enter into the self-designed creative module through this interface, and then complete the creative design according to the specified requirements.

The duration of this competition is 4 hours.

312

4

=+++

240

14:00

15:0015:30

15:3016:00

16:3017:30

17:30

7:30

7:007:30

7:308:00

8:0012:00

12:0014:00

13:0014:00

13:0014:00

14:0020:00

8:309:30

( )

1www.chinaskills-jsw.org)

1.

2.

3.

1

2

3

4.

5.

130%15%

2

35%

5%

2

UI

5%

2

5%

UI

5%

/

2

9%

ActivityServiceBroadcast ReceiverContent Provider

9%

10%

Handler//

10%

Handler/

10%

6%

API

10%

Shared Preferences

10%

6%

2

a) 100%

b) 0%

a) 100%()

b) 0%

a)

1.100

2.=+++

3.221213414

4.

5.18

6.

7.30%15%

8.5%

9.0

10%20%30%

1

GB/T162602006

2

GB/T93852008

3

GB/T189052002

4

GB/T8567-2006

5

SJ/T11291-2003

3111Android

1

i3VT8G200G1024x768USB

2

i38G200G1024x768USB

3

1.4GhzARM Cortex-A9 quad-core2GB DDR38GB iNand12V/2A100/10MbpsRJ451920*1080 SD

ETC

4

Android

CPUARM Exynos4412 Quad-core

1.4~1.6GHz

2G Bytes DDR3

iNAND 8GB

FlashNAND FLASH

PMUPMUACT8847

LCDLVDSVGA(THS8136PHPVESA)

DM900010M/100M

USBUSB Host2.0

HDMIAHDMI1.43D1080P

4UART

1

Windows 764

jdk-8u66-windows

Android Studio v2.2

SDK PlatformsAndroid 4.0.35.06.07.0SDKAPIsIntel x86 64 Image

gradle-3.3-all

Build Tools Version21.0.022.0.023.0.024.0.025.0.0

Office2010(wordvisio)

2

ETC

1.

2.

3.UPS

4.

1.

2.12

3.

1.

2.

3.

4.

1.

2.

3.

4.

5.

1.

2.

3.

/

1

5

2

4

2

3

2

1

3

0

5

10

5

2

0

4

4

3

()

42

201820182018

1.

2.

3.

1.

2.

3.

4.

5.

1.

2.

3.

4.

5.

1.

2.

3.

4.2

5.2

6.

7.

514772112

1

Android

1

21

1

1

Android

25

1

1

Java

1

31

1

1

23

1

1

Java Web

1

21

1

1

HTML5

21

1

1

HTML5

22

1

1

16

41677

1500

30

840220

6000

2018

AndroidHTML5

C

SDK

5845200300

35300500

30

1

20171220183

2

20183

20183

201835

201835

3

2018455

2018552

2018555

IT

2018420185

20185

20185

1

1

2

4

3

3

4

14

22

1www.chinaskills-jsw.org

O2O

2018

Android 4.0.3Win 71381100

240

1.

2.

3. APKU

4. U1

5. APP

http://192.168.1.106:8080/transportservice/

admin/admin

1-2

1-3

1-3

GitStack

http://192.168.1.106/gitstack/

admin/admin

1-4 GitStack

1

1

2

3

1

2

3

4

5

6

7

8

1

ETC

U

37 / 60

1 5

U

1 APP3

2-1

APP2-1APPAPP

2 APP3

2-2

1 2-2

2 2-3

user1user2user3user4user5123456admin/admin

2-3

3 APP4

2-4

1

2

3 APP

1 9

1~4ETC

3-1

3-2

3-1

1

1~4APP

# ffcc00

2 ETC3-2

1999

3

4

5 APPSQLite+

2 8

3-3

3-3

1

2 31212

3-1

1

2

3

4 31220/

3-4

5 39011~153-4

3 8

3-5

3-5

user1user2user3user4user5123456admin/admin

1

2

3

3-6

4

5

4 8

3-7

3-7B10001XXXXXXX3-8

B10001B10002B10003B10004B10005

3-8

3-9

3-8

1 +3-73-9

2 3-10

3-10

3-104APP3-11

3-11

3-11

5 8

3-12

3-12

1

2 3

3-2

1

2

3

4

5

6

7

3-3

1

2

3

4

5

#6ab82e

#ece93a

#f49b25

#e33532

#b01e23

3 PM2.5

4

5 APP

6

7 1

6 14

4

3-13

3-13

1 4

2 3PM2.5

0,1000

[1000,3000]

3000,

SPF12~15PA+

SPF15PA+

,8

[8,

,12

[12,21]

21,

T

0,3000

[300,6000]

6000,

PM2.5

0,30

[30,100]

100,

3 PM2.5

X60331

Y1

1

i. PM2.53-131103

3-14

ii. 3-141: 25 , : 16

3-15

iii. 3-15167%

3-16

iv. 3-16197

7 14

3-17

3-17

3-18

3-18

3-19

3-19

3-20

3-20

3-21

3-21

3-22

3-22

3-23

3-23

8 10

3-24

3-24

1 3-24

3-25

2 3-25

APP

3-26

3 3-26

1-41-4

31-4APPAndroidAPP

1 6

1

2

3

4

60